I can confirm that.

My samples never make it into daily. I am very frustrated about that.
I use the same link to upload as Wagner,
http://www.clamav.net/report/report-malware.html,
enter my full name, my email, check notify me, check share this sample
with other AV vendors, upload the malware file and submit the malware
report.

The submit procedure is successful every time as I get the
http://www.clamav.net/report/success.html page every time.

In the last three days I uploaded a sample, I don't know how often
I uploaded it. Every day I checked if clamav could detect the virus
in the sample after a new daily arrived.
And every day clamav couldn't detect it.
I checked on three different machines, linux, windows and openbsd.

Virustotal.com says about my sample:
SHA256: bb1e635aa88a6906473713bd49368553f49c21e885c1586742542b3fee4b405c
Dateiname: ccp.exe
Erkennungsrate: 42 / 57
Analyse-Datum: 2015-01-28 09:32:11 UTC ( vor 0 Minuten )

If I imagine how often this possibly happens and how many samples it
never make into daily, then this could be one of the main reasons
why clamav has such a terribly bad detection rate.

So, what can we do to remedy the problem and make the
detection rate of clamav better ?
